Mercedes Bens Fasion Week in Miami

Mercedes-Benz Fashion Week Swim is presented annually in Miami Beach, Florida, at The Raleigh Hotel. Coinciding with the swimwear industry’s largest trade show, the invitation only event provides a runway platform for designers’ swimwear and resort collections with exposure to national and international media, style setters and fashionistas. Fashion, beauty, supermodels and celebrities come together in South Beach to celebrate the sexiest swimwear designs in the world. <

Art Basel Miami Beach: a cultural and social highlight for the Americas

June 15th, 2008 Posted in Uncategorized | 2 Comments »

Art Basel Miami Beach is the most important art show in the United States, a cultural and social highlight for the Americas. As the sister event of Switzerland’s Art Basel, the most prestigious art show worldwide for the past 38 years, Art Basel Miami Beach combines an international selection of top galleries with an exciting program of special exhibitions, parties and crossover events featuring music, film, architecture and design. Exhibition sites are located in the city’s beautiful Art Deco District, within walking distance of the beach and many hotels.

An exclusive selection of more than 220 leading art galleries from North America, Latin America, Europe, Asia and South Africa will exhibit 20th and 21st century artworks by more than 2,000 artists. On show are exceptional pieces by both renowned artists and cutting-edge newcomers. Special sections (listed at left) will feature projects by emerging artists, new artworks, public art projects, performances, video and sound art.

Art Basel Miami Beach takes place December 4 - 7, 2008.

Fairchild Garden World of tropical plants in Coral Gables, Miami

May 15th, 2008 Posted in Uncategorized, attractions, neighborhood | No Comments »

Fairchild Tropical Botanic Garden is a botanic garden, with extensive collections of rare tropical plants including palms, cycads, flowering trees and vines, located in Coral Gables

The garden was established in 1938 by David Fairchild, one of the great plant explorers, and Robert H. Montgomery, an accountant, attorney, and businessman with a passion for plant-collecting.

He retired to Miami in 1935, but many plants still growing in the Garden were collected and planted by Dr. Fairchild, including a giant African baobab tree and a medium-sized coonatorius palm tree not far from the entrance.

Documented botanical specimens provide valuable resources in science and education, while horticultural displays and the classic landscape design by William Lyman Phillips offer visitors an unforgettable aesthetic experience.

Welcome to Miami’s beautifull Doral

May 8th, 2008 Posted in Shopping, Uncategorized, neighborhood | No Comments »

Golfcourse Miami Dade

The City of Doral is a city located in north-central Miami-Dade County, Florida, west of Miami International Airport; Doral is a suburb of Miami, Florida. The City of Doral takes its name from the famous golf and spa resort located within its municipal boundaries.

The Doral Golf Resort & Spa was originally built by Doris and Alfred Kaskel, who coined “Doral” by combining their names.

Doral has a large number of shops, financial institutions and businesses, especially importer and exporter companies, primarily because of its location situated adjacent to the Miami International Airport.

In 2008 Doral was listed as 51 on a list of 100 cities by Fortune Small Business and CNN Money ranked with the best mix of business advantages and lifestyle appeal.

Miami Based Psystar creates Apple Mini Clone

April 14th, 2008 Posted in Uncategorized | No Comments »


Via Engadget.com:

Psystar’s offer to build off-license OSx86 OpenMac clones was apparently pretty popular — we saw a note from the company saying it was trying hard to cope with the rush of traffic, but it looks like things got overwhelming, and the site is now down. People are speculating that Apple already shut things down, but that’s pretty unlikely: nothing on the Psystar site infringed any of Apple’s IP (as far as we can recall) and the company hadn’t actually sold anything yet, which means there isn’t much of anything for Apple to go to court over.

On top of that, we doubt that Psystar wasn’t expecting to attract Apple’s attention, so we don’t think a cease and desist letter would scare the company into shutting things completely down.

Of course, we’re still willing to bet that Apple’s legal team is licking their chops in anticipation of something actionable happening, but we’d say the most interesting thing about this so far is the incredible amount of attention a low-cost expandable minitower running OS X has gotten — maybe someone at Apple apart from the lawyers should be taking notes as well.
